Lately, the interest in residence Daycare Near Me By State facilities is on the rise. With more and more parents looking for versatile and inexpensive childcare choices, house daycare providers are becoming a popular choice for many families. However, as with any type of childcare arrangement, there are both positives and negatives to think about with regards to residence daycare.

One of many advantages of home daycare is the tailored care and attention that kids get. Unlike larger daycare centers, house daycare providers typically have smaller categories of kiddies to look after, permitting them to give each kid much more personalized attention. This can be specifically good for children which may need extra support or have unique requirements. Besides, home daycare providers frequently have even more flexibility inside their schedules, letting them accommodate the needs of working parents and also require non-traditional work hours.

An additional benefit of residence daycare may be the home-like environment that children are able to encounter. In a home daycare environment, kiddies have the ability to play and learn in a comfortable and familiar environment, which can help all of them feel safer and calm. This can be specifically good for youngsters who may have trouble with split anxiety whenever becoming remaining in a larger, much more institutionalized daycare setting.

best-friends-childhood-girls-young-teen-secret-cute-faces-reaction-thumbnail.jpgResidence daycare providers additionally usually have even more flexibility when it comes to curriculum and activities. In a house daycare setting, providers have the freedom to modify their particular programs to your specific needs and interests of children in their care. This will probably allow for more innovative and personalized understanding experiences, and that can be very theraputic for young ones of all of the ages.

Despite these advantages, there are some disadvantages to think about with regards to residence daycare. One of the most significant concerns that moms and dads could have could be the lack of oversight and regulation in residence daycare facilities. Unlike larger daycare centers, which are often at the mercy of strict certification requirements and regulations, home daycare providers might not be held to the exact same requirements. This can raise problems towards quality and safety of treatment that children receive in these settings.

Another potential downside of residence daycare is the restricted socialization options that young ones may have. In a house daycare setting, children are usually only reaching a little band of peers, that may perhaps not give them similar level of socialization and experience of diverse experiences they would obtain in a larger daycare center. This is a problem for parents who price socialization and peer discussion as important aspects of their child's development.

Also, house daycare providers may face challenges in terms of balancing their caregiving obligations using their personal resides. Many house daycare providers tend to be self-employed that can struggle to find a work-life stability, especially if these are typically taking care of kids in their own personal homes. This could easily induce burnout and stress, that may ultimately affect the standard of care that kiddies obtain.

In general, house daycare may be a great option for households finding flexible and customized childcare options. However, it is very important for moms and dads to very carefully consider the positives and negatives of residence daycare before making a decision. By weighing the advantages and cons of residence daycare and performing thorough analysis on possible providers, moms and dads can make certain that these are typically determing the best childcare option for kids.

In summary, house daycare can be an invaluable and enriching experience for the kids, supplying all of them with tailored care, a home-like environment, and flexible programming. But moms and dads should know the possibility downsides, such as restricted supervision and socialization opportunities, and take steps to ensure that they are selecting a professional and top-notch residence daycare provider. With careful consideration and study, residence daycare could be a confident and fulfilling childcare choice for many households.
